Budgeting
Although it might not sound exciting, the fact is that budgeting yourself is the first and most essential step towards greater financial security. This is because budgeting, when it’s done right, can make a huge difference to how much money you spend overall, as well as how much you can later put aside for a rainy day. Most people fail to budget at all; then there are others who do manage to budget, but only for a few choice things. However, this is unlikely to make the kind of difference that you probably hope for. If you want to see your finances take a great step forward in your life, then you need to budget yourself strictly, down to the last penny. This is the only way to really take control of your finances.

Cutting
When it comes to many of the other essentials, such as your household bills, it is often much harder to find something in the way of competition, no matter how hard you try. However, just as often there is usually some possibility available to simply cut those bills, ensuring that you spend only what is necessary. Often, it is plausible to call up your supplier and see if there is a cheaper tariff. If one is available, switching is likely to be a good idea, as it should save you a decent amount of money in the long run. Alternatively, or additionally, you might want to think about lowering your usage. This is the single most effective way of lowering your household bills, so it is worth thinking about.
